Mike Morath had set a goal to make Texas No. 1 in education 10 years ago. At that time, he emphasized delivering great results for all students, particularly brown and Black kids. National test scores now indicate that more work is needed to achieve this goal.

While there has been some improvement, such as fourth grade math students rising from 18th to 8th, the state still ranks in the bottom third of the country. Morath remains confident that his efforts have improved children's lives, citing increased student learning in areas under his governance.
